#448baa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#448baa is composed of 26.7% red, 54.5%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 198.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 46.7%. #448baa color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ffff with #001755.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#448baa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#448baa has RGB values of R:68, G:139,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4492202.

Shades and Tints of #448baa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#448baa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72797c is the less saturated color, while #04a4ea is the most saturated one.
